Description
Technical Field
The utility model relates to a grinder technical field, more specifically says, the utility model relates to a workpiece fastening device for grinder.
Background
The grinder is a common machine used for sharpening various cutters and tools and is also used for deburring, cleaning and the like of common small parts.
In the processing process of the existing grinding machine, an operator needs to hold a workpiece by hand and place the workpiece on one side of a grinding wheel for processing, and the arm of the operator is close to the grinding wheel, so that the risk of being cut by the grinding wheel exists; in addition, after the clamping assembly is arranged on the grinding machine, the workpiece cannot move after the clamping assembly clamps the workpiece, the grinding wheel can be machined only by being close to the workpiece, the position of the grinding wheel can be adjusted, and the mode is single.

Detailed Description
In order to make the technical problems, technical solutions and advantages to be solved by the present invention clearer, the following detailed description will be given with reference to the accompanying drawings and specific embodiments.
The embodiment of the utility model provides a workpiece fastening device for grinder as attached figure 1 to 5, including grinder main part 1, grinder main part 1's front demountable installation has operating panel 2, operating panel 2 and the inside motor electric connection of grinder main part 1, and one side fixed mounting of grinder main part 1 has adjustment assembly 3.
Wherein, adjustment subassembly 3 includes horizontal plate 31, and spout 32 has been seted up on the surface of horizontal plate 31, and the inside sliding connection of spout 32 has slider 33, has seted up spout 32 through the surface at horizontal plate 31 for first hydraulic stem 34 can drive slider 33 at the back-and-forth movement of spout 32, thereby adjusts the distance between the emery wheel of work piece and abrasive machine main part 1.
Wherein, one side fixed mounting of spout 32 inner chamber has first hydraulic stem 34, one side and the 2 electric connection of operating panel of first hydraulic stem 34, one side and the fixed surface of slider 33 of first hydraulic stem 34 are connected, the top fixed mounting of slider 33 has centre gripping subassembly 35, through setting up first hydraulic stem 34 and 2 electric connection of operating panel, operating personnel presses operation panel 2's button back again like this, can control first hydraulic stem 34 and remove in spout 32, the operating personnel of being convenient for carries out the operation of switch.
Wherein, clamping component 35 includes second hydraulic stem 351, the bottom of second hydraulic stem 351 and the top fixed connection of slider 33, and the top fixed mounting of slider 33 has joint piece 352, and side opening 353 has been seted up to one side of joint piece 352, and the work piece has been placed to the inside of side opening 353, and screw 354 has been seted up at the top of joint piece 352, and the bolt 355 is installed to the internal thread of screw 354.
One side of the second hydraulic rod 351 is electrically connected to the operation panel 2, and the clamping block 352 is made of a metal member.
The working process of the utility model is as follows:
the workpiece fastening device for the grinding wheel machine is characterized in that the clamping assembly 35 is arranged, an operator puts a workpiece into the clamping block 352 through the side hole 353, the top of the workpiece is fixed through the mounting bolt 355, and then the workpiece is processed by the processing control part through pressing the button of the operation panel 2.
According to the scheme, the workpiece fastening device for the grinding wheel machine is arranged through the adjusting component 3, after a workpiece is placed in the clamping block 352 and fixed, the first hydraulic rod 34 is controlled to drive the workpiece to move back and forth through the operation panel 2, and the second hydraulic rod 351 is controlled to drive the workpiece to lift, so that the distance between the workpiece and the grinding wheel is adjusted, and the grinding wheel can process the workpiece conveniently.
